Output 88e2aed43ca369bf74132cfa5722c637d05a6727addf575051f14c4c3190801e:1

value
133559633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3daea5c06cf8a0eafd625ad18a6d9c21341b95b OP_EQUAL
address
3J618PqyLDbXUowkJg16yTMGAsEYxLRwQ8
transaction
88e2aed43ca369bf74132cfa5722c637d05a6727addf575051f14c4c3190801e
spent
true